Understanding Treadmills with Incline
An incline treadmill is a basic treadmill that enables users to adjust the angle of the running surface. With this feature, individuals can mimic walking or running uphill, presenting an extra difficulty to their workout. This not only bolsters the intensity of workouts but likewise includes different muscle groups, improving the overall efficiency of the exercise.
Key Features of Incline Treadmills
When considering an incline treadmill, prospective buyers need to take note of the following features:

Adjustable Incline: Most incline treadmills permit a range of Incline Treadmill For Sale settings, from a gentle slope to high angles, catering to numerous fitness levels and exercise objectives.

Motor Power: Considerable horsepower is essential for a treadmill's motor, particularly for keeping performance at greater inclines. Try to find models with at least 2.5 to 3.0 continuous horse power (HP) for optimal functioning.

Running Surface: A wider and longer belt improves convenience and lowers the threat of injury. Runners should aim for a belt that's at least 20 inches broad and 55 inches long for a comfortable stride.

Built-in Programs: Many incline treadmills feature preloaded workout programs, consisting of interval training, heart rate control, and hill exercises, making it easier to keep exercises varied and engaging.

Heart Rate Monitor: Integrated heart rate keeping an eye on help in tracking fitness levels and making sure workouts stay within preferred intensity zones.

Foldable Design: Many modern treadmills include a foldable design, making them easy to store in smaller sized home.

Cushioning Technology: Advanced cushioning systems can decrease influence on joints and make exercises more comfy, which is important for longer exercise sessions.
Benefits of Using an Incline Treadmill
Buying an incline treadmill can substantially contribute to physical conditioning. Here are some notable benefits:

Enhanced Calorie Burning: Walking or operating on a slope increases calorie expenditure. Research study shows that high-incline running can burn up to 50% more calories compared to working on a flat surface area.

Muscle Activation: Incline workouts trigger numerous muscle groups differently, engaging the hamstrings, calves, and glutes better than flat running. This causes greater muscle strength and meaning with time.

Cardiovascular Health Improvement: Regular usage of an incline treadmill can enhance the cardiovascular system. Elevated heart rates during incline workouts boost heart and lung capability, enhancing total endurance.

Minimized Impact: Walking Treadmill With Incline or working on an incline is generally gentler on the joints compared to operating on a flat surface area. The incline lowers the influence on knee and hip joints, making it a suitable alternative for people with previous injuries or those vulnerable to joint pain.

Flexibility of ATM (At-Home Training): The convenience of a treadmill permits exercise flexibility. Users can suit brief sessions throughout the day or engage in longer, more focused workouts without leaving home.

Versatile Workout Options: Incline treadmills permit users to quickly incorporate interval training or hill workouts into their routines, making the exercises promoting and avoiding redundancy.
Tips for Effective Workouts on an Incline Treadmill
To optimize the advantages of using an incline Folding Treadmill With Incline, think about the following ideas:

Start Slow: If you are brand-new to incline workouts, start with a moderate incline (around 1-3%) and gradually increase as your physical fitness level enhances.

Include Interval Training: Alternate in between high and low inclines to keep the workout engaging and optimize calorie burn.

Concentrate on Form: Maintain an upright posture while utilizing the incline treadmill. Avoid leaning on the hand rails, as this can reduce workout strength and efficiency.

Stay Hydrated: Ensure proper hydration before, throughout, and after workout. Dehydration can impede efficiency and recovery.

Mix it Up: Combine walking, running, and performing at home treadmill with incline numerous inclines to keep exercises varied and exciting.
Frequently Asked Questions About At-Home Incline Treadmills1. Why should I choose an incline treadmill over a regular treadmill?
An incline treadmill supplies the added advantage of adjustable slopes, permitting more intense exercises that enhance calorie burning and muscle activation. This versatility can result in much better overall physical fitness results.
2. Can a beginner use an incline treadmill?
Yes, beginners can use incline treadmills. However, it is advisable to start at a lower incline and slowly increase the intensity as endurance and fitness enhance to avoid injury.
3. What are the very best incline settings to start with?
Starting at a 1-3% incline is advised for newbies, enabling the body to adapt to the new movement pattern safely. Then users can gradually increase the incline gradually based on convenience and fitness levels.
4. Is it safe to work on an incline treadmill?
Yes, working on an incline treadmill is generally safe. However, it is necessary to keep correct kind and posture to minimize the risk of injury. Beginners must start gradually and speak with a physical fitness professional if unpredictable.
5. How much area do I need for an incline treadmill?
The quantity of space required differs depending upon the specific design. Nevertheless, it's generally suggested to enable at least a 6-foot clearance behind the treadmill and 2 feet on either side for security and convenience.
